HARLEQUINS FRENCH LEAVE: Racing Metro 40 - Harlequins 28

Looked pretty ominous in the first minutes with Dumas going over for a try inside 3 minutes with an easy conversion by Sexton. Quins got their offloading game going, awarded a penalty in Racing 22, Quins elected to scrum got ball away and Ugo lost control of the ball over the line. 5m scrum to Racing which was won by Quins and there followed a series of scrums with Racing eventually getting the ball away. 

A period of sustained pressure by Quins with a series of penalties against Racing (think the ref had lost his yellow card) rewarded by an 
Ugo try converted by Nev, 7 points all after 30 minutes. 
Ugo really looking good and was tackled 5m short of the line and spilled the balll. 

Racing second 15 started their warm up routine, looks like a complete change is planned for the second half! 

JTH off with what looked like a cut eye Mike Brown on. 

Lineout to Racing inside Quins 22, catch and drive made to look very easy, try to Lydiate and converted by Sexton on 34 minutes. Racing reduced to 14 men shortly after following a very late and dangerous tackle on George Lowe I think.

Quins scored their second try shortly before half time with George Lowe scoring from a delicate kick through by Nev, brilliant.

Nick Easter off just before half time replaced by a very slim and fit looking More.

Half time 14 points each. 

Quins had looked very sharp with lots of offloading in the first half against a very big physical side. 

Easter and JTH both back on for second half, lost count of the Racing replacements as many were wearing shirt numbers 1 to 15. 

Another catch and drive score by Racing after 42 mins, conversion missed by Sexton. Quins scored next following a quick penalty and darting run by Dickson (had a good game) with who else but Ugo finally touching down, conversion by Nev after 45 minutes. 

Noticed that Buchanan and Sinkler (I think) were on, Sam Smith injured and Mike Brown back on but to be honest couldn't keep up with some of the changes from here on. JTH off again, Robson off, Sam Stuart on with me trying to take photos as well!! 

Racing new pack started to take control up front with lots of pressure on Quins line awarded by another converted try. Noticed Mike Brown coming off again.

Great try saving tackle by Ugo (back to his best chasing all the restarts) but Quins under loads of pressure resulting in another converted try after 73 minutes.

Racing's final score was from a superb chip through and chase, score 40 - 21.

Quins stuck to their task and were rewarded by an individual try by George Lowe in the dying minutes, converted by Ben Botica, final score 40 - 28.
